Tanzanite Engagement Rings

A tanzanite engagement ring features a blue-violet zoisite center stone — a gemstone first identified in 1967, found commercially in only one location on earth (the Merelani Hills of northern Tanzania), and prized for a rare optical property called pleochroism, which causes the stone to display different colors when viewed from different angles. Tanzanite occupies a specific niche in engagement ring design: distinctly blue-violet color found in no other widely available gemstone, genuine geographic rarity, and a price point well below comparable sapphire while remaining accessible at engagement-appropriate sizes.

Why a Tanzanite Engagement Ring Feels Rarer Than Diamond

Diamonds are forever; they are also everywhere, mined on four continents and graded into commodity. Tanzanite's entire supply comes from a few square kilometers, and widely reported estimates give the accessible deposit a working life measured in decades. Choosing it says the quiet part of a proposal out loud: this is not the expected thing — it is the singular one.

The Blue-Violet Fire No Other Gemstone Carries

Tanzanite is strongly pleochroic: the crystal transmits blue along one axis and violet along another, so the finished stone changes character with every turn of the wrist — sapphire-cool in office daylight, unmistakably violet across a dinner table. Cutters orient each stone to lead with blue or with violet, and neither choice is wrong; it is the movement between them that no sapphire, spinel, or diamond will ever perform — a genuine optical signature rather than a marketing flourish.

In an engagement context that restlessness becomes the metaphor the ring was always reaching for — a stone with more than one way of being beautiful, depending on the light you meet it in. An Honest Word on Tanzanite Durability

We would rather tell you at the point of falling in love than after: tanzanite measures 6 to 7 on the Mohs scale, softer than sapphire, softer than quartz. It is a stone for a considered life, not a careless one — take the ring off for the gym, the garden, and the moving day, and never clean it ultrasonically; the vibration is the one real hazard. Warm water, mild soap, and a soft cloth are all it ever needs.

The settings do the rest of the protecting. Bezels wrap the girdle in metal; halos and hidden halos take knocks before the center does; cathedral shoulders shelter the stone's flanks. This is why our bridal tanzanite skews toward protective architecture rather than exposed claws — the romance of a rare stone should not depend on the wearer being lucky.
